Paradise Park, CA vs Trinity Village, CA
Paradise Park is moderately more affordable than Trinity Village, with a 7.4% lower cost of living index. Paradise Park scores 104 compared to 113 for Trinity Village,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Trinity Village can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.
Median household income in Paradise Park is $73,640 compared to $83,620 in Trinity Village (-11.9%). While Trinity Village is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income.
Climate-wise, Paradise Park is notably warmer with an average of 57.2°F compared to 52.5°F in Trinity Village. Trinity Village receives more rainfall at 46.1" per year compared to 22.4" in Paradise Park.
